Abstract
A radially polarized beam is generated from a laser by means of a resonant grating mirror. The design results and spectral characterization of a broadband polarizing mirror are presented as well as the mirror's operation in a laser resonator. In a long-term experiment a radially polarized beam with a power of was observed for several hours, proving the high stability of this polarizing scheme.
